Sovos is a high-substance enterprise platform that successfully anchors its ‘AI-powered’ marketing in massive, verifiable processing metrics. It avoids nearly all standard accounting BS patterns by focusing on technical integration and measurable cost reductions for named global corporations. It is a benchmark for how to use ‘Signal’ to lead directly to documented ‘Substance.’
To further reduce the BS score, add Person schema and professional bios for a selection of the ‘150+ tax experts’ to ground the human expertise claim. Replace the superlative ‘most sophisticated agentic AI’ with a technical whitepaper link or specification of the agentic framework used. Explicitly link the ‘Half the Fortune 500’ claim to a client logo wall or verified customer list. Convert the generic ‘Resources’ H2 headings into specific, noun-heavy titles like ‘Tax Compliance Research & TCO Analysis.’
The site maintains a high ratio of substance to fluff, citing specific metrics such as 16B transactions processed and 100K global companies. However, approximately 40% of the H1-H2 headings, such as ‘The backbone for global tax compliance,’ utilize power-word metaphors without immediate technical nouns. The body text significantly recovers density by naming specific clients like Philips and Nationwide alongside measurable outcome percentages.

The homepage H1 ‘AI-Powered Global Tax Compliance’ is strictly aligned with the sub-page product modules including e-Invoicing and Tax Determination. There is no evidence of drift; the site does not promise advisory and deliver only filing, nor does it target enterprises while showing freelancer-grade content. The messaging is consistently scaled for high-volume corporate users across all sections.

With a review_count of 22 and proof_links_count of 1, the site avoids major trust theatre flags by grounding its primary claims in hard data. While the ‘Half the Fortune 500’ claim is an unlinked assertion, the inclusion of specific performance metrics for Philips (80% cost reduction) and Nationwide (34% fewer penalties) provides legitimate substance. The site lacks the typical ‘five-star rated’ or ‘award-winning’ badges that often signal empty trust theatre.
The proof density is high, with over 8 distinct proof points including named clients (Philips, Nationwide), exact transaction counts, and specific country coverage. The ratio of verifiable evidence to vague marketing assertions is approximately 4:1, which is elite for the industry. The inclusion of a recently dated webinar (April 15, 2026) further reinforces active, current authority.

The value proposition is highly differentiated through its ‘agentic AI’ focus and coverage of 200 countries, moving beyond the generic ‘save you money’ cliches of small accounting firms. Some template fingerprints appear in sections like ‘Resources to help you on your tax compliance journey,’ which follow a standard SaaS content marketing structure. Clichés like ‘One global platform’ are common in the industry but are here supported by technical breadth.
A notable authority gap exists in the mention of ‘150+ Tax experts’ without providing individual names, credentials, or Person schema to verify their expertise. The Organization schema is technically excellent, featuring multiple sameAs social links and a clear publisher identity, though it lacks specific founder or leadership team data in the primary structured data block. This creates a reliance on institutional authority rather than individual expert proof.
The marketing tone is largely justified by the data demonstrated; the claim of being a ‘backbone’ for tax is supported by the 16B transaction figure. Unlike firms that claim ‘peace of mind’ without evidence, Sovos uses technical specifications like ‘Information Reporting and Withholding Suite’ to define its value. The only disconnect is the ‘agentic AI’ claim, which functions as a modern buzzword without a detailed technical framework provided in the text.
